Vacuuming

Vacuuming using a robot hoover is a simple, quick way to keep your floors clean and tidy. A lot of the models we've chosen are designed to run without your involvement, so you can set them up to clean your floors while you're out or start an appointment from your phone. But, you must choose a model that has excellent navigation and obstacle detection to ensure it will not get stuck on the stairs or underneath furniture.

It's important to select a robot vacuum that can effectively and efficiently clean all types of flooring. Look for a robot with a large dustbin that will hold a lot of dirt in between emptyings and a nozzle that does not lose suction as it turns.

Most robots require little to no maintenance, aside from cleaning the tangled fur off the rotating brush after every cleaning session (and wiping its camera or sensors when needed) and regularly emptying the bin or using a robot's self-emptying base. If you follow these easy maintenance tips, your robot vacuum should last as long as regular vacuums and keep your home cleaner for longer.

Cleaning apps

Most robot vacuums, mops, and sweepers come with an application that lets you alter the cleaning routines. You can also select rooms to be cleaned, plan cleaning sessions, and alter settings such as suction levels, water levels and scrubbing strength. Some robots also offer intelligent dirt detection, which makes use of the data from previous cleaning sessions and maps information to prioritize areas of dirt and optimize cleaning mode.

Having an app also allows you to set up virtual barriers and no-go zones to keep your robot away from potentially hazardous items such as cords or pet water bowls and sharp objects. Certain models let you create these virtual barriers with laser navigation sensors, whereas others feature small physical boundaries or barriers that which you can put wherever you want to block off your floor area.

The most effective robot vacuums and mops are smart robot vacuums enough to detect obstacles and maneuver around them however there are certain dangers to be on the lookout for. For instance, the main brush could get stuck in long cords or curtains and stop the machine dead in its tracks. You can prevent this by clearing the area of all cords and tying off any curtains that are long before operating your robot vacuum cleaner.

Certain robots automatically update their software that regulates the algorithm for navigation and obstacle avoidance. This enhances performance and reduces wear and tear of the robot's internal parts. It's a good idea regularly to check the website of the manufacturer or your robot app for updates to firmware.
